If it's like my g-shocks you should be able to set-up time, day, date etc etc by holding down the top left button (adjust) until the display starts to flash..... then scroll thru to the day, date or whatever you want to set up by pressing the bottom left button (mode) and stop on the one you want to change..... then you can change it either plus or minus using the buttons on the right..... when you've got it how you want it just pass the adjust button again..... clear as mud??

You'll also see a screen that says DST (and you activate that if it's daylight savings time otherwise leave it off).
